In a landmark move to bolster India's diplomatic presence in Europe, Prime Minister Narendra Modi today arrived in Poland. Ministry of External Affairs spokesperson, Randhir Jaiswal said that PM Modi will first visit to pay his homage to the three memorials.

External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ar called on Malaysia's Prime Minister Anwar Ibrahim on Tuesday and said that he values his guidance to take the India-Malaysia partnership to new heights.

Deuba expressed her commitment to further strengthen the bilateral ties. She thanked PM Modi for India's Neighbourhood First Policy and various development cooperation undertaken by India with Nepal.
External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ar held discussions with his Nepali counterpart, Arzu Rana Deuba, on Monday and discussed multifaceted cooperation in trade, energy, and infrastructure development between the two countries.
External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ar on Monday welcomed his counterpart from Nepal, Arzu Rana Deuba on her first visit to India as the Foreign Minister.
